
Senior Full Stack Engineer
- Belfast
- Permanent
- Full-time
- Build highly performant, scalable SaaS applications using PHP and Symfony.
- Craft beautiful and responsive frontend experiences using AngularJS and Typescript.
- Develop new product features across web and mobile platforms via Kadence's RESTful APIs.
- Collaborate closely with a cross-functional team including engineers, QA, data, infrastructure, product managers and designers to deliver high-impact features.
- Contribute to architectural decisions and help shape our technical direction.
- Write clean, secure, maintainable code with performance and usability in mind.
- Investigate and resolve technical issues through hands-on debugging and research.
- Maintain and evolve automated tests to ensure product quality.
- Create and maintain internal technical documentation and share knowledge with the team.
- Proven experience building large-scale consumer web/mobile applications and distributed systems.
- Strong backend experience (ideally with PHP and Symfony).
- Strong frontend development experience with TypeScript (AngularJS preferred) to create interactive user interfaces.
- Familiarity with distributed systems and modern cloud architecture.
- Passion for writing clean, maintainable code and continuously improving practices
- You must be comfortable with rapid development in a Agile / Scrum environment and iterating based on market and customer feedback.
- Excellent collaborator and communicator within your team and the wider company.
- BSc in a related field such as Computer Science, Computer Engineering, or other software/design discipline.
- Backend: PHP 8.2 / Symfony 7, REST, API Platform, NodeJS, Python, Rust.
- Frontend: TypeScript, Angular 19.
- Mobile: Android (Kotlin), iOS (Swift)
- Desktop: Cross platform desktop app built with Electron (TypeScript)
- Database: MySQL (Aurora DB), Redis (ElastiCache), MongoDB (AWS DocumentDB)
- Cloud & DevOps: AWS (20+ services), Kubernetes (EKS), Docker, Infrastructure as Code (CloudFormation, Terraform), CI/CD (Jenkins, GitHub Actions), Observability (AWS, Grafana)
- Development tools: GitHub, Jira, Notion, ChatGPT, Gemini, LangChain, AI-native IDE's (Cursor, JetBrains), LLM-powered internal tools.
- A front-row seat in a fast scaling, early stage startup.
- Working on cutting edge problems with brand new technologies.
- Join a passionate and fun team that is quickly expanding in Belfast and beyond.
- Remote first with the ability to work from our sleek office in the heart Belfast city centre with access to a rooftop terrace, private member coffee lounge and regular wellbeing events.
- Regular company socials including an annual offsite to get to socialise with your colleagues in person.
- 5 weeks vacation per annum (plus public holidays), flexible work/life balance.
- Competitive salary and stock options.
- Private healthcare and company pension.
- Cycle2work scheme.